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6912 9657 030473683 920506 5665
693692 9512 93955532
693692 9512 93955532
82584021 9706728 3705380157
All about undefined
Interested in learning more?
693692 9512 93955532
82584021 9706728 3705380157
See more
89839 8476 54251
9786 59500040 703 240508
See more
6665578852 963866
42 130 08177448 30548 50740594
See more